Hey All,

I know we just started Nur Ein, but to get us excited about Song Fight Live: Denver I wanted to see if folks would be interested in Video Coverfight again.

Here are the details:
For those who are unfamiliar, an Original Flava Coverfight is where Songfighters cover the songs of their fellow Songfighters. The way this works is that folks post here that they're "in." After some period of time, the covermaster (me) will covertly message you with the randomly selected name of someone else who signed up. It's then up to you to pick which of that person's songs you want to put your own unique spin on. Make a video of that song. Submit it by the deadline.

In order to participate in this, you will need to have at least one song, preferably more, present in your artist archive. It's fine to use any artist/band you've materially participated in. Suggest these when post that you are "in."

I was thinking about having sign ups until June, then using much of June for everyone to make their cover/video with a late June Livestream on Youtube.

Sound good? Who's in?
